I replaced the video card in an AMD64 pc with FC3-x86_64 with
a new card (nVIDIA GeForce FX5200 replaced by a nVIDIA GeForce
FX5700 LE) and used kudzu to remove the old adapter and install
the new. (Kudzu reacted correctly at boot).

As I do not like using gdm/rhgb I always configure for runlevel 3
and use 'startx'.
Before using 'startx' I edited xorg.conf with the correct entries.
This is for a LCD monitor using DVI and the 'nv' driver.

However now 'startx' either remains at the black screen or progresses
to the blue Gnome startup background (on which normally the Fedora splash
screen appears with the changing icons before you see the panel, etc.)
but then no Gnome desktop.

I have checked the xorg log file in /var/log and other logs for any
indication of video problems but everything appears OK.

So I think something happened to the Gnome configuration somewhere.
I see errors like the following:
(Gnome-panel:3671): Gtk-WARNING **: cannot open display: :0.0

Any suggestions how to solve this. I really need the GUI at the moment.
